I have re-worked the bike kid’s walking animation and given it a lot more life. In the old one the only moving part of the sprite was the feet of the kid doing the cycling. Now his head bobs back and forth and his arms move a little bit as he is cycling. The girls piggy-tails are moving in the wind too to give the feeling of speed. I have also re-worked the sponge animation to make the sponge look less solid. People were saying it looked like you were shooting yellow bricks at the kids so I decided to make the sponge move more and give it an even more cartoon-ish look.
